Add the bay leaf, banana blossoms, brown sugar, salt … The Bisaya Pork Humba is a pork dish that originated in the Visayas region, and similar in appearance to the classic and well-known dish, the adobo. This is more popular in the Visayas and Mindanao region here in the Philippines and is considered as one of the best delicacies there.
